Great to meet you!

I work with adults who have already been in treatment, but still feel that their diagnosis or care plan never fully made sense.

Some have tried multiple medications with only partial improvement. Others have received different diagnoses over time without clear explanation. Many are left feeling uncertain about what is actually driving their symptoms.

My practice is built around a more structured, diagnostic-first approach. I focus on clarifying the clinical picture before making treatment changes, so that recommendations are thoughtful, targeted, and easier to follow and make sense of.

This is often a good fit for patients seeking:

• second-opinion evaluations

• diagnostic clarification

• medication reassessment

• a more careful and individualized approach to care

I provide telehealth care for adults across California and Hawaiʻi.

My approach to therapy

My approach is grounded in careful listening and a structured psychiatric assessment.

I focus on understanding how symptoms affect attention, mood, sleep, energy, and daily functioning — not just how they appear on a checklist. When prior treatment hasn’t fully worked, we slow down and look more closely at the underlying clinical picture.

This often involves revisiting the diagnosis, identifying overlapping conditions, and refining treatment strategy to be more precise and sustainable.

Medication management, when indicated, is deliberate and evidence-based. The goal is not rapid changes, but steady, meaningful improvement supported by clear clinical reasoning.

My focus is diagnostic clarity, treatment precision, and long-term functional progress.

What you can expect from me

The first session is comprehensive and structured.

We will review your history in detail, including prior diagnoses, medications, therapy experiences, medical conditions, sleep patterns, and current concerns.

You can expect:

• Thorough diagnostic assessment

• Clear explanation of clinical reasoning

• A collaborative and individualized treatment plan

• Thoughtful, structured follow-up

If you are seeking a second opinion or a more thorough reassessment of your care, you will find that the pace is intentional and the clinical reasoning is clear.
